본문 바로가기
Backend/Java

[Java]Hello World 출력하기

by sukii 2023. 11. 22.
반응형

✨프로젝트 / 패키지 / 클래스

1. java1 프로젝트를 먼저 만들고

2. basic 패키지를 만들고

3. HelloWorld 클래스를 만들어서 코드를 작성했음.

 

 

🖥️Hello World 출력 코드 

package basic;

public class HelloWorld {
	 public static void main(String[ ] args) {
		 System.out.println("안녕하세요.");//println은 줄바꿈이 됨
		  System.out.print("Hello, World");//print는 줄바꿈 안됨
		  System.out.println("반갑습니다.");/* 출력매소드 호출 */
	 }
}

 

위의 코드 설명을 위한 이미지

 

클래스 & 메소드

빨간색 박스 = 클래스 블록

public class HelloWorld = 클래스 선언부

HelloWorld = 클래스 이름

 

파란색 박스 = 메소드 블록

public static void main(String[ ] args) = 메소드 선언부

main  = 메소드 이름

 

실행문

메소드 블록 내에 다양한 실행문들을 작성

System.out.println("안녕하세요."); 
System.out.print("Hello, World"); 
System.out.println("반갑습니다.");

 

실행문 끝에는 세미콜론(;)을 붙여 실행문이 끝났음을 표시한다.(보통 우리가 쓰는 문장의 마침표와 같은 개념)

 

System.out.println 은 출력 후 줄바꿈이 되고,

System.out.print는 출력 후 줄바꿈이 되지 않는다.

 

아래 이미지를 보면,

println 메소드를 쓴 "안녕하세요"는 줄바꿈이 되어있고, 

print 메소드를 쓴 "Hello, World"는 줄바꿈이 되지 않아 "반갑습니다"가 바로 뒤에 이어 출력되는 것을 볼 수 있다.

Console에 출력된 결과

 

**코드를 실행하려면 단축키 [Ctrl]+[F11]을 누르면 된다. 그러면 위 사진처럼 Console에 결과가 뜸.

 

 

주석

코드에 대한 설명을 달고 싶을 때는 주석을 사용함.

//라인주석: 한줄만 주석 처리

/* */ 범위 주석 : /* 부터 */ 사이에 있는 모든 내용을 주석 처리

 

 

 

 

 

 

반응형